Shrub pruning is a important practice for keeping healthy, attractive shrubs while controlling their size and shape. Pruning eliminates dead, harmed, or infected branches, motivates new development, and promotes blooming or fruiting. Each shrub types may have specific pruning requirements, including timing, cut positioning, and strategy. The process includes evaluating the plant's structure, selectively cutting branches, and thinning dense locations to enhance airflow and light penetration. Seasonal considerations guarantee that pruning does not interfere with blooming cycles or stress the plant during vital development periods. Consistent shrub pruning improves both visual appeal and plant health. Appropriate care permits shrubs to maintain a well balanced kind, flourish in the landscape, and contribute positively to the general design of the outside space
